Understanding Website Speed and Performance
Website speed refers to how quickly your web pages load and respond to user interactions. Performance encompasses speed but also includes stability, responsiveness, and efficient resource use. Improving these factors ensures users can access your content with minimal delay, regardless of their device or network conditions.
Key metrics include:
- Page Load Time
- Time to First Byte (TTFB)
- First Contentful Paint (FCP)
- Largest Contentful Paint (LCP)
- Cumulative Layout Shift (CLS)
These indicators help you measure how your website performs and where improvements are needed.

Common Problems Affecting Website Speed
Many factors can slow down your website. Recognizing these problems is the first step toward improvement:
- Large Images and Media Files: Unoptimized images increase load time.
- Excessive HTTP Requests: Too many scripts, stylesheets, and plugins cause delays.
- Slow Server Response: Poor hosting or server configuration affects TTFB.
- Lack of Caching: Without caching, content loads from scratch every visit.
- Uncompressed Files: Large CSS, JavaScript, and HTML files consume bandwidth.
- Outdated Software: Old CMS versions or plugins can be inefficient or insecure.
How to Improve Website Speed and Performance
Here are actionable steps you can take to enhance your website speed and overall performance effectively:
- Optimize Images: Use modern formats like WebP and compress files without losing quality.
- Minimize HTTP Requests: Combine CSS and JavaScript files, reduce plugins, and streamline code.
- Enable Caching: Use browser and server caching to store static resources locally.
- Use a Content Delivery Network (CDN): Distribute your content globally to reduce server load and latency.
- Choose Quality Hosting: Opt for reliable servers with fast response times and scalability.
- Minify Code: Remove unnecessary characters from CSS, JavaScript, and HTML files.
- Leverage AI Tools: Use AI-powered analytics to identify bottlenecks and automate optimizations.
- Implement Lazy Loading: Load images and videos only when they enter the viewport.
- Regularly Update Software: Keep CMS, plugins, and libraries current to ensure efficiency and security.
Tools and Software to Boost Performance
Several digital tools can assist you in speeding up your website with minimal effort:
- Google PageSpeed Insights: Provides detailed performance reports and improvement suggestions.
- GTmetrix: Analyzes page speed and identifies specific issues.
- Cloudflare CDN: Enhances delivery speed and protects against cyber threats.
- WP Rocket: A popular caching plugin for WordPress sites.
- ImageOptim and TinyPNG: Tools for compressing images efficiently.
- New Relic: Advanced monitoring for server and application performance.

Comparison of Performance Optimization Tools
| Tool | Primary Use | Pros | Cons |
|---|---|---|---|
| Google PageSpeed Insights | Performance analysis and suggestions | Free, detailed reports, mobile and desktop | Limited automation, requires manual fixes |
| Cloudflare CDN | Content delivery and security | Fast global network, DDoS protection | Some features require paid plans |
| WP Rocket | Caching plugin for WordPress | Easy setup, great performance boost | Paid plugin, WordPress only |
| GTmetrix | Page speed testing and analysis | Comprehensive diagnostics, historical data | Limited free usage |
